   40 applications is a whole lotta applications to compile, and I believe
the project is going to compile all of them.  Maybe you could create
different projects with the applications and use a library project for
shared code?  Less would need to be re-compiled each time.

Hello. I've been using Flex 2 for 3 months now. There's around 40 mxml
applications plus component, and actionscript files in the project and
the compilation (building) time has considerably increased with
time...taking up to 5-10 minutes at times. I've upgraded to Java
1.5.0.09 and changed the settings in the FlexBuilder configuration
file and still no significant improvements have been noticed. Could
anyone help me out with this issue.

Deleting the Bin folder and re-compiling the whole project as well did
not solve the problem.
